She asked and he said yes

One of the leap year traditions states a woman can ask a man to marry her. After a dare Amanda Fasen did just that.

POLOKWANE – On 20 February Fasen asked her boyfriend, Michael Cooper, to marry her…

Their story is not your classic love story, they’ve known each other for six years, but ended their relationship when Michael moved to Johannesburg, Amanda moved to Mokopane during this time. Michael moved back to Polokwane and they started to visit each other frequently again. They soon realised the spark was still there and Amanda moved back to the city last January.

“As per her request, I made sure to be home early on Monday (20 February), and expected the evening to be a normal date night,” Michael said.

“I bought a ring for him a while ago, and a few days before I decided to ask him to marry me everything was almost spoiled as the ring fell out of my pocket and he saw it. Luckily I have quite a few rings myself so he did not suspect anything,” she laughed.

“I made reservations at Ocean Basket Mall of the North and wanted to ask him by ordering a sushi platter with the words ‘marry me’, but the manager suggested he organised dancers to do a special dance for us and at the end they will have a banner with the words ‘marry me’ written on it.”

When they arrived at the restaurant everything seemed as usual and they placed their orders, this was shortly followed by the dance.

Amanda pointed out the dancers to Michael and he soon started to notice this was not just the usual type of dance often seen at the restaurant.

“I noticed her friends and several papers lying on the ground. When the singing stopped I turned around to ask the reason and saw her waiting on one knee with the ring in her hand. I couldn’t believe what was happening and shook my head a couple of times, but I said yes,” Michael said.

Amanda said she was so scared he would say “no” that she cancelled their orders and paid the bill for the sushi platter beforehand.

“I asked his mother, father and brother for permission to ask him to marry me. I am so grateful to be part of such a loving family,” Amanda said.

“I planned to propose to her later in the year as I wanted to finish my qualification and then get settled, but this was an awesome surprise. We had our ups and downs, but I am happy we have come this far. Also, another bonus is the date of the anniversary as I only have to buy a gift every four years,” Michael laughed.
